Summary:This research is a quantitative study that aims to determine the effect of financial literacy, innovation, and the role of government in the development of SMEs. The population in this study are SMEs in the District of Cipayung, East Jakarta. The sample size was taken as many as 100 samples, with non-probability sampling method in particular is Purposive Sampling. Data collection was carried out through questionnaires with a sample of 100 respondents. The analysis technique used is the Partial Least Square (PLS) analysis method. the results of this study indicate that (1) financial literacy has no significant effect on the development of SMEs with a path coefficient of 0.051. (2) innovation has a significant influence on the development of SMEs with a path coefficient of 0.77. (3) the role of government has a significant effect on the development of SMEs with a path coefficient of 0.178.
